Postmedia News: Rockies, other geography made Canada’s West a dinosaur hotbed

Aug 05, 2012

Western Canada’s remarkable dinosaur riches can be traced in large part to the birth of the Rocky Mountains and other geological forces that combined to create a multitude of isolated animal habitats in the region about 75 million years ago, according to a new U.S.-led study.
